Projects
- I wrote one of the MusicCollectionTools in Perl- Point it at a directory of MP3s and based on existing Album MBID tags, it'll populate your collection.
- http://muz.goatse.co.uk/musicbrainz/asinsearch.php - Whack in an album MBID and it'll search all 6 Amazon domains looking for potential ASINs. This is a bit half-baked and I should touch it up at some point.
- To build upon the aforementioned, this is now available as a GreaseMonkey script. Please see this Userscripts.org page
- http://muz.goatse.co.uk/musicbrainz/parsertext.php - Enter an album MBID and it'll return output which is usable by the Text Parser on any add release page. Makes duplicating release info easy.
